Garden Route

The Garden route is an amazing and scenic road trip that takes you through the heart of the Western Cape in South Africa from Cape Town to the border of Tsitsikamma Storms River in the Eastern Cape. Undoubtedly the most scenic part of the Western Cape, with undulating roads, spectacular ocean views, unspoilt beaches, mountain passes, ancient forests, gruelling hiking trails, delightful food and craft markets. The name comes from the verdant and ecologically diverse vegetation encountered here and the numerous estuaries and lakes dotted along the coast. It includes towns such as Knysna, Plettenberg Bay, Mossel Bay, George, Wilderness, and Sedgefield.

Many of the highlights along the route include, Gondwana Game Reserve near Mossel Bay, Knysna Heads and Knysna Lagoon, nature trails and beach walks at Wilderness and the award winning Tenikwa Wildlife Awareness Centre
